1966 Alfa Romeo Spider vs. 2003 Skoda Superb

To start off, 2003 Skoda Superb is newer by 37 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ider would be higher. At 2,769 cc (6 cylinders), 2003 Skoda Superb is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2003 Skoda Superb (190 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 27 more horse power than 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ider. (163 HP @ 5900 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2003 Skoda Superb should accelerate faster than 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2003 Skoda Superb weights approximately 246 kg more than 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 2003 Skoda Superb (280 Nm @ 3200 RPM) has 60 more torque (in Nm) than 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ider. (220 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 2003 Skoda Superb will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ider.
